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Concrete: Different concrete types, such as stamped or colored, have varying prices.
- Thickness of the Slab: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ive.
- Preparation Work: Costs can rise if significant ground preparation or excavation is needed.
- Complexity of Design: Intricate designs and patterns can add to labor costs.
-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Fort Pierce, FL, may vary and impact the total price.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Additional Features: Extras like borders, finishes, or embedded lighting can increase cost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Fort Pierce, FL)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Slab | $4 - $8 per square foot |
Stamped Concrete | $10 - $15 per square foot |
Colored Concrete | $6 - $12 per square foot |
Concrete Patio Installation |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Concrete Driveway | $3,000 - $7,000 |
Concrete Walkway |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Concrete Pool Deck | $5,000 - $12,000 |
Excavation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Concrete Sealing | $1 - $3 per square foot |
